    To then Secretary of the Treasury Salmon P. Chase

    Dear Sir:

    You are about to submit your annual report to the Congress respecting the affairs of the national finances

    One fact touching our currency has hitherto been seriously overlooked. I mean the recognition of the Almighty God in some form on our coins.

    You are probably a Christian. What if our Republic were not shattered beyond reconstruction? Would not the antiquaries of succeeding centuries rightly reason from our past that we were a heathen nation?

    What I propose is that instead of the goddess of liberty we shall have next inside the 13 stars a ring inscribed with the words PERPETUAL UNION; within the ring the allseeing eye, crowned with a halo; beneath this eye the American flag, bearing in its field stars equal to the number of the States united; in the folds of the bars the words GOD, LIBERTY, LAW.

    This would make a beautiful coin, to which no possible citizen could object. This would relieve us from the ignominy of heathenism. This would place us openly under the Divine protection we have personally claimed. From my hearth I have felt our national shame in disowning God as not the least of our present national disasters.


    Rev. M. R. Watkinson, Minister of the Gospel from Ridleyville, Pennsylvania, November 13 1861.


    As a result, Secretary Chase instructed James Pollock, Director of the Mint at Philadelphia, to prepare a motto, in a letter dated November 20, 1861.

    IN GOD WE TRUST first appeared on the 1864 two-cent coin.

    The first paper currency bearing the motto entered circulation on October 1, 1957.
